Meaning

Audiology diagnostic equipment refers to specialized medical devices and technologies designed for the evaluation and assessment of hearing and balance functions. These tools include audiometers, tympanometers, otoacoustic emission analyzers, vestibular function testing systems, and other instruments used by audiologists and healthcare professionals to diagnose and manage auditory and vestibular disorders.

Category-wise Insights

  1. Audiometers: Audiometers are the cornerstone of audiology diagnostic testing, offering precise measurements of hearing thresholds and frequency-specific audiometric assessments. Technological advancements in audiometry include digital signal processing, automated testing protocols, and integrated data management systems.
  2. Tympanometers: Tympanometers assess middle ear function by measuring acoustic impedance and compliance of the tympanic membrane and ossicular chain. Tympanometry plays a crucial role in diagnosing conditions such as otitis media, eustachian tube dysfunction, and tympanic membrane perforations.
  3. Otoacoustic Emission Analyzers: Otoacoustic emission analyzers measure cochlear hair cell function by detecting sound emissions generated in the inner ear in response to acoustic stimuli. Otoacoustic emissions testing is used for newborn hearing screening, diagnostic assessment of cochlear function, and monitoring of hearing aid efficacy.
  4. Vestibular Function Testing Systems: Vestibular function testing systems evaluate balance function and vestibular reflexes through a battery of tests, including caloric testing, rotational chair testing, videonystagmography (VNG), and vestibular evoked myogenic potentials (VEMP). These tests aid in the diagnosis of peripheral and central vestibular disorders.
